Objective: To develop the scale of competency for clinical nursing teachers.The scale include establishing clinical nursing teachers competency basedcharacteristics items and its dimensions,which is available for selecting clinicalnursing teachers, assessing, training, and guiding Career Development and Planning.Methods: The qualitative and quantitative research method was used. Formingscale was based on the concept of the competency of clinical nursing teachers. Anditems were compiled by reviewing literature and semi-structured interviewing15undergraduate nursing students. Ten experts and ten undergraduate nursing studentsevaluated the content validity and face validity. Adopting the method of convenientsampling, we selected70nursing undergraduates of the First affiliated Hospital ofDaLian Medical University as evaluators, and28clinical nursing teachers as theobjects evaluated. Distinguish degree was used to verify of all the items;Factoranalysis was used to test the structure validity of the scale; Cronbach’s alphacoefficient was used as an index of internal consistency; The correlation coefficientof two parts was evaluated to calculated split-half reliability.Results:1. Form of initialization questionnaireThe initialization scale was established by reviewing literature andsemi-structured interview. It included37items and6dimensions: professionalquality, professional attitude, professional ability, teaching ability, interpersonalcoordination ability, personality traits.2. Selection of items and reliability and validity on the competency assessmentscale for clinical nursing teachers.2.1Selecting every item and divided into the high score group and the lowscore group,which was compared. Finally,37items are statistically significant.2.2Validity①Face validity and content validity: the content validation rate ranged from0.8to1.0. The content of scale is appropriate, comprehensive, andaccurate.②Construct validity:it is significance correlation between sub-scale andscale (P<0.01). The correlation coefficient between sub-scale and sub-scale is lessthan between sub-scale and scale.Six factors were extracted by using principal factoranalysis and varimax rotation, cumulative contribution is71.26%. The factor loadingwith each item of the scale is above0.4. The result indicated that the structure of thescale was similar to the theory construction.2.3Reliability①Internal consistency reliability: The Cronbach’s alphacoefficient of psychosocial adaptation questionnaire is0.977. Alpha coefficient of6sub-scale ranges from0.808to0.942.②Split-half reliability:0.852.Conclusion:The developed scale showed good reliability and validity. It waspractical and worthy of promotion.
